Chiho Nakagawa

Dr Chiho Nakagawa is an Associate Professor at Nara Women’s University in Nara, Japan. Her research interests include American women’s literature, Gothic novels, and more recently, crime fiction. Chiho has published in various international and Japanese journals and contributed book chapters, including “Safe Sex with the Defanged Vampires: New Vampire Heroes in Twilight and the Southern Vampire Mysteries” (2011). Her contribution to Asian Gothic lies largely in her discussion of Seishi Yokomizo—who turned her interest into crime fiction—which appeared in Transnational Horror Across Visual Media: Fragmented Bodies (2013). She also translated David Mitchell’s Cloud Atlas to Japanese (2013).
